你查询的IP:[121.4.35.66]  地理位置:中国–上海–上海

最新查询59.80.25.58 119.4.189.9 61.48.18.84 203.100.32.91 58.144.73.8 58.66.22.47 202.2.176.5 58.24.12.16 120.80.4.94 121.4.35.66 203.90.128.86 202.143.16.103 210.15.216.88 117.53.48.216 210.78.35.180 119.15.136.51 202.4.128.136 222.160.136.164 61.240.168.9 203.88.32.216 202.160.176.6 203.88.32.184 119.88.238.75 202.127.208.42 125.96.180.57 202.69.4.241 119.40.244.118 202.69.4.119 210.5.144.244 117.40.201.148 122.156.21.186